dc.description.abstractA phytochemical investigation of Eugenia uniflora’s leaf extract resulted in the isolation of eleven phenolic compounds: 2,3-di-O-galloyl--D-glucose (1), 1,2,3,4,6-penta-O-galloyl--D-glucose (2), gemin D (3), hippomanin A (4), oenothein B (5), eugeniflorin D2 (6), camptothin A (7), afzelin (8), quercitrin (9), myricitrin, (10) and desmanthin-1 (11). These compounds were identified by spectroscopic methods including 1D- and 2D-NMR, UV, IR, and TOF/MS. Compounds 1, 2, 3, 4, 7, 8, 9, and 11 were isolated from this species for the first time. Ten isolates were evaluated for antioxidant activity by DPPH free radical and Oxygen Radical Absorbance Capacity (ORAC-Fluorecein) assay. Dimeric tannins, oenothein B (5), eugeniflorin D2 (6), and camptothin A (7) showed a remarkable radical scavenging capacity.pt_BR
